Coach Contepomi selects Los Pumas squad for matches against New Zealand.

Following the July inbound Tests, Los Pumas are preparing for a demanding schedule with their sights set on the Visa Banco Macro Rugby Championship, which will begin with a visit to New Zealand to play their first two matches of The Rugby Championship. Felipe Contepomi's team will travel first to Wellington in preparation for the first Test against the All Blacks on Saturday 10 August at Sky Stadium; the second match will be in Auckland, at the legendary Eden Park, on Saturday 17 August.

The Pumas come into the Championship after having achieved two victories and one defeat in the July Window, while the All Blacks, with the recent debut of Scott Robertson as head coach, achieved three wins in a row: two against England and one against Fiji. The last match between both teams was in the semi-finals of the 2023 World Cup in France, with a victory for the men in black by 44-6.

For the tour of New Zealand, Felipe Contepomi has selected a squad of 31 players that will have six returning players and a debut call-up to the senior team: Lucio Cinti, Agustín Creevy, Juan Martín González, Tomás Lavanini, Juan Cruz Mallía and Joel Sclavi will return to the team after missing the July Tests following their participation in the 2023 World Cup in France. Efraín Elías, captain of Los Pumitas in the recent U20 World Cup, will have his first appearance in the Los Pumas senior sqaud.

Jerónimo de la Fuente, a player from Rosario who recently reached 80 caps with Los Pumas, will not participate in the 2024 Rugby Championship due to  personal reasons.


Felipe Contepomi, head coach of Los Pumas, commented: “After meeting up with the squad for the three weeks of the July Window, we now have the enormous challenge of starting a new Rugby Championship and continuing to build and evolve as a team. For the first two matches with New Zealand we have a list of 31 players and something important to note is that this list is not definitive for the rest of the competition, but may be modified as the tournament progresses.

“On the other hand, we want to thank the Argentine public for their enormous support in the first three matches of the year and we are looking forward to meeting again in La Plata, Santa Fe and Santiago del Estero in the coming weeks.”
